diff options
author | Colin Snover | 2016-02-18 12:10:35 -0600 |
---|---|---|
committer | Colin Snover | 2016-02-18 13:18:03 -0600 |
commit | 3e820ee9b36b1fc2cf6516d400f1433d2238082f (patch) | |
tree | 29c6aa74bfa9cec782f86290101ca2dc239cd822 /engines/sci/graphics/plane32.cpp | |
parent | 5a1fa5efa1459d7859432b21749587ef67f002d5 (diff) | |
download | scummvm-rg350-3e820ee9b36b1fc2cf6516d400f1433d2238082f.tar.gz scummvm-rg350-3e820ee9b36b1fc2cf6516d400f1433d2238082f.tar.bz2 scummvm-rg350-3e820ee9b36b1fc2cf6516d400f1433d2238082f.zip |
SCI: Fix bad positioning of relatively positioned pic cels
Diffstat (limited to 'engines/sci/graphics/plane32.cpp')
-rw-r--r-- | engines/sci/graphics/plane32.cpp |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/engines/sci/graphics/plane32.cpp b/engines/sci/graphics/plane32.cpp index 33c01cf828..38ce78dc75 100644 --- a/engines/sci/graphics/plane32.cpp +++ b/engines/sci/graphics/plane32.cpp @@ -183,7 +183,7 @@ void Plane::addPicInternal(const GuiResourceId pictureId, const Common::Point *p screenItem->_priority = celObj->_priority; screenItem->_fixPriority = true; if (position != nullptr) { - screenItem->_position = *position; + screenItem->_position = *position + celObj->_relativePosition; } else { screenItem->_position = celObj->_relativePosition; } |